Environmental Impact and Evaluation Methods of Near-Field Electromagnetic RadiationFrom Mobile Communication Base Stations
This paper assessed the environmental impact of near-field electromagnetic radiation from mobile com-munication base stations and explored evaluation methods.Field testing and numerical simulation were combined to evaluate the environmental impact of near-field electromagnetic radiation characteristics of two typical base sta-tion antennas(ODV-090R17K and ODV-065R15B).Field test results showed that ODV-065R15B formed a high field strength concentration area at medium distances(4-7m)with a maximum field strength of 5.075 V/m,while ODV-090R17K had a relatively uniform field strength distribution with a maximum of 3.819 V/m.Simulation model validation indicated good results for both antennas.Further simulation analysis revealed differences in radi-ation characteristics between the two antennas in various directions.The research provides scientific basis for as-sessing the environmental impact of mobile communication base stations and offers references for optimizing base station site selection and antenna configuration.
